C# Класс Dominion.BagOfCards

Наследование: CollectionCards
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
AddCard ( Dominion.Card card ) : void
BagOfCards ( CardGameSubset gameSubset ) : System
BagOfCards ( CardGameSubset gameSubset, BagOfCards parent ) : System
Clone ( ) : BagOfCards
CopyFrom ( BagOfCards other ) : void
RemoveCard ( Dominion.Card cardType ) : Dominion.Card
ToString ( ) : string

Приватные методы

Метод Описание
MoveAllCardsFrom ( CollectionCards other ) : void
RemoveCard ( CardPredicate acceptableCard ) : Dominion.Card
RemoveSomeCard ( ) : Dominion.Card

Описание методов

AddCard() публичный Метод

public AddCard ( Dominion.Card card ) : void
card Dominion.Card
Результат void

BagOfCards() публичный Метод

public BagOfCards ( CardGameSubset gameSubset ) : System
gameSubset CardGameSubset
Результат System

BagOfCards() публичный Метод

public BagOfCards ( CardGameSubset gameSubset, BagOfCards parent ) : System
gameSubset CardGameSubset
parent BagOfCards
Результат System

Clone() публичный Метод

public Clone ( ) : BagOfCards
Результат BagOfCards

CopyFrom() публичный Метод

public CopyFrom ( BagOfCards other ) : void
other BagOfCards
Результат void

RemoveCard() публичный Метод

public RemoveCard ( Dominion.Card cardType ) : Dominion.Card
cardType Dominion.Card
Результат Dominion.Card

ToString() публичный Метод

public ToString ( ) : string
Результат string